A dental impression is a negative imprint of hard (teeth) and soft tissues in the mouth from which a positive reproduction (cast or model) can be formed. They are used to create a close replica of your teeth, your oral tissue or both.
There are three primary types of dental impressions: preliminary, final and bite registration: Preliminary impressions: Preliminary impressions are used for diagnostic purposes, or as the initial step in the process of fabrication (making) of different prostheses, including crowns and dentures.
Drags are a byproduct of depressions being left in the impression material when the tray is inserted, and they often cant be repaired simply by adding more material. Pulls result when extraneous material creates a fold most often at the gingival aspect.
Not all the teeth have been captured in the impression. Solution: Trying the tray in the mouth and looking to see if the tray is the correct size is the most common error. Fill tray properly with impression material. Failure to get the proper amount of impression material will prevent an accurate impression.
Usually, voids at the margin are because of insufficient retraction or where fluid has accumulated, preventing the impression material from flowing around the margin. Using retraction cords with syringeable hemostatics is the best way to solve this problem. One technique is to use a double retraction cord.
Smear the impression material (ex: alginate) onto the occlusal surfaces of the teeth and into undercuts by finger pressure before the impression tray is placed. This prevents the occurrence of trapping bubbles in the impression.
Voids are commonly identified as holes on the margin of the prepared teeth. Sometimes voids can lead to margins which are incomplete. This can cause short crown margins and/or open margins in the final restoration. Learn common ways to adjust the dental impression procedure to minimize voids.
The amount of water required to mix with powder is greater than the amount required for the reaction. This excess water vaporizes during stiffening and a mass of interlocking gypsum crystals is formed. Voids occur between these crystals after evaporation of the water.
